Subject: Re: Can't mate with K+R vs K

Well, this is one of the few things my Pedestrian does well :-).
So, I basically use only two things and it works really quickly.

1) Piece-square table penalizing the opposing king for being near the edge of
the board, and especially in the corner.

2) Reward my king for being close to the opposing king (forget centralization
etc. - just chase the guy).

This works well for me in K+Q v K, K+R v K, K+BB v K.
Only for K+BN v K I have to use additional piece-square tables for my minors and
two piece-squares for the opposing king (depending which B I have).
